Pokémon and Jumputi Heroes Creators Launch Pandoland Globally on Android
Pandoland has officially launched on Android worldwide today, marking a significant milestone for fans eagerly awaiting its global release. Developed by Game Freak, the masterminds behind the iconic Pokémon series, and in collaboration with WonderPlanet, the creative force behind Jumputi Heroes, Pandoland has been captivating audiences in Japan since last year and is now ready to enchant players globally.
Let the Treasure Hunt Begin!
In Pandoland, you step into the shoes of an explorer leading a squad on a thrilling journey through a vast, mysterious region shrouded in a fog-of-war. As you progress, you'll uncover the map, discovering hidden gems and encountering the unexpected. With over 500 unique companions to meet and legendary treasures to collect, each exploration enhances your team's capabilities. Dungeons serve as your primary battlegrounds where you'll gather new allies and treasures, all of which contribute to your growing library, powering up your squad for future adventures.
While Pandoland offers a rich solo experience, it truly shines when you explore with friends. The game encourages cooperative play, allowing you to team up, share discoveries, and uncover rare quests and hidden treasures together.

A Pandoland Launch Campaign Is Going on Android
To celebrate the global Android launch, Game Freak and WonderPlanet have kicked off several exciting campaigns. Inviting friends to the game rewards you with an SR ticket upon completion of the invites. Additionally, there are enticing free rewards up for grabs, including 15,000 Diamonds for logging in for 30 consecutive days, an SR character named Charlotte, and useful items like Meat on the Bone and 500 coins to kickstart your adventure.
